CVE-2021-39125 vulnerability in Atlassian Products
Published on September 14, 2021
Vulnerability Analysis
CVE-2021-39125 can be exploited with network access, and does not require authorization privileges or user interaction. This vulnerability is considered to have a low attack complexity. The potential impact of an exploit of this vulnerability is considered to have a small impact on confidentiality, a small impact on integrity and availability.
